Parking at the Shanghai Airport

There are 218 parking spaces available at the airport. Off-site parking is also available and many parking lots offer buses or shuttle vans to the airport. Airport parking fees vary based upon the size of the car and the number of hours parked. Mini-type cars begin at 10 RMB for the first hour. Big-sized cars begin at 20 RMB for the first hour.

Transportation to the Shanghai Airport

Travelers departing from the Shanghai Airport can choose to take the Shanghai Maglev Train. The journey takes about eight minutes, and trains depart every 15 minutes. The cost of a standard ticket is usually 50 RMB. Other transportation options include the Shanghai Metro Line 2 for a cost of between 3 RMB and 10 RMB. The airport also operates its own bus line. Fees range between 2 RMB and 22 RMB based on distance.

Located 17 miles from downtown, the Pittsburgh International Airport is the biggest airport in the city, and it was once the primary hub for US Airways. Though the company no longer operates from that airport, Southwest Airlines, JetBlue, and Delta Air Lines still do. Pittsburgh also has two other airports located in the outer suburbs: Allegheny County Airport, which primarily serves private and charter planes, and the Arnold Palmer Regional Airport, which works with Sprint Airlines. As these airports are on the outskirts of the city, it might take an hour or more to reach the city.

Port Authority of Allegheny County, also known as PAT Transit, is the mass transit system in the city. Public transportation takes you to the top destinations, hotels, and airports in the city, and most rides cost less than $5.
